REV: 03-25-25 MI <br />Exhibit “A” <br />SCOPE OF SERVICES AND FEE <br />Section 1. Data Processing, Printing and Mailing Services: Consultant will provide data <br />processing, printing and mailing services consisting of processing data, printing documents, <br />mail preparation, applying postage (where applicable) and sending via the United States <br />Postal Service. Document types include but are not limited to bills, postcards and letters. <br />A. Data Transfer and Processing <br />•City to transmit data to Consultant in an agreed upon format. Changing the <br />data file format requires additional professional services to setup and <br />program changes to the new file format. <br />•A File Transfer report will be emailed to the City representatives who have <br />opted-in to this email. A copy of this report is also available to download <br />from the Consultant website. <br />•City will have access to an online Job Tracking application that shows the <br />progress of each file as it is processed and becomes a batch of documents <br />to be printed and mailed. City can see both the original input file name and <br />the Consultant-assigned “Job Code”. <br />•Consultant will process the mailing addresses and perform the following <br />functions: <br />o Apply CASS-certified address validation <br />o Comply with USPS requirements to obtain pre-sort automation rates <br />for qualified City mail pieces <br />o Stay current with all USPS regulations required to mail presorted <br />first-class mail <br />•Consultant will optionally provide proofs of the final print-ready PDF files to <br />City to be reviewed and approved before printing begins (if requested). <br />B. Document Printing and Mailing <br />•Batches are printed by Consultant using a high-speed production process <br />onto the agreed upon forms. <br />•Printed documents are put through a quality control process and then <br />released to the mailing department to be inserted into outgoing envelope. A <br />return envelope and any applicable inserts are included as defined by City <br />workflow. <br />•After a batch of mail is completed in Consultant's system it will be marked <br />as such in the online Job Tracker and a Process Confirmation Report will <br />be emailed to the City representatives who have opted-in to this email.
